I realize this is not likely to happen, but here goes--

I work with a group that has 20-30 broadcasting students -- we use vmix for all of our productions -- but there is no easy way to train the students---- We need a version that allows for full functionality so groups of 15-20 can train at one time in a lab situation -- the basic version is not enough -- perhaps a version with ndi out disabled and output limited top 320x240.... Just so we can learn the interface and all the features without having to buy 15-20 individual licenses.
